Canon ELPH 510 HS vs Nikon P7100 Physical Comparison

If you are planning to lug around your camera, you are going to need to take into account its weight and measurements. The Canon ELPH 510 HS comes with physical measurements of 99mm x 59mm x 22mm (3.9" x 2.3" x 0.9") and a weight of 206 grams (0.45 lbs) and the Nikon P7100 has proportions of 116mm x 77mm x 48mm (4.6" x 3.0" x 1.9") having a weight of 395 grams (0.87 lbs).

Canon ELPH 510 HS vs Nikon P7100 Sensor Comparison

Sometimes, it's tough to picture the gap in sensor measurements simply by looking through technical specs. The visual below will offer you a much better sense of the sensor measurements in the ELPH 510 HS and P7100.

As you can tell, the 2 cameras feature different megapixel count and different sensor measurements. The ELPH 510 HS because of its smaller sensor is going to make achieving shallower DOF more challenging and the Canon ELPH 510 HS will provide you with more detail due to its extra 2 Megapixels. Greater resolution can also make it easier to crop images way more aggressively.
